No matter the reason for getting online — whether it’s purely for entertainment or strictly for business — there’s no doubt that the internet experience vastly improves when the speeds are faster. And for today’s internet consumers, both at the office and in the home, fiber optics is clearly the future of data transport.
Allowing for massive data bandwidths and the absolute fastest internet speeds,fiber is today’s most sought-after method for sending and receiving data. The technology uses laser pulses to transmit billions of bits of data per second through long, thin strands of glass — at speeds more than 100 times faster than traditional, non-fiber!
Consumers should consider these many benefits of fiber-optic internet connections for both residential and business use:
Fiber in the home
Today’s homes are increasingly filled with a range of smart devices, each of which uses up bandwidth to connect to the internet. From smartphones, gaming systems and smart televisions to computers, tablets and even video doorbells, these devices need ample bandwidth to work well. Problems arise when a residence’s bandwidth is insufficient — especially when all of a home’s connected devices are working at once. If there’s not enough bandwidth, the simultaneous connections can cause speeds to screech to a halt, and even bring the dreaded buffering that leads to painfully slow speeds.
But with a fiber-optic connection, bandwidths can increase exponentially and speeds can go through the roof, even when multiple devices are connected. A fiber-optic connection to the home along with the appropriate internet plan can bring benefits like:
- Zero buffering
- Super-fast downloads and uploads
- The ability to stream OTT TV service, movies and music on multiple devices at the same time
- Low latency and ping speeds, providing a superior online-gaming experience with a competitive advantage
- Improved reliability and reduced susceptibility to inclement weather such as lightning
- Easy remote maintenance
Gigabit internet is the fastest connection available in the United States and can only be accomplished with fiber-optic service. A few download examples that demonstrate the power of Gigabit are:
- 25 songs in 1 second
- an entire television show in less than 3 seconds
- a full, high-definition (HD) movie in just 36 seconds
Fiber in the office
For modern businesses, the advantages of a fiber-optic connection are also extensive. With the significantly higher bandwidths that a fiber internet connection can deliver, the faster speeds bring significant benefits such as improved:
- Web conferencing
- File sharing, no matter the file size
- Audio quality for users of VoIP and PBX, business-class phone systems that use an internet connection
- Internal and external collaboration
- Streaming of high-definition video (such as training videos)
Additionally,fiber internet plans for businesses are often symmetrical, which means the upload and download speeds are the same.This can be particularly advantageous on the upload side, where businesses often need higher speeds for file-sharing purposes. Other distinct advantages a fiber connection can offer businesses include:
- Reliability —Fiber-optic internet is not as susceptible to inclement weather, which can affect or even stall data transmission. Unless physically cut, fiber remains the most reliable form of communications connection today.
- Cloud Access and Hosted Services —The speed, bandwidth, reliability and low-latency capabilities of fiber internet provide the best possible access to a business’s hosted services and cloud-based applications.
